ChatGPT训练需要什么硬件

ChatGPT训练所需的硬件

ChatGPT是一种基于大型神经网络模型的自然语言处理工具,它需要大量的计算资源来进行训练。在选择合适的硬件设备时,需要考虑CPU、GPU、内存等方面的要求。

CPU要求

  • ChatGPT的训练过程中,CPU主要负责数据的预处理和模型参数的更新,因此需要一定的计算能力和多核处理器的支持。
  • 推荐选择高性能的多核CPU,比如Intel Core i9系列或AMD Ryzen Threadripper系列。

GPU要求

  • 由于深度学习模型的训练对于并行计算能力要求较高,因此GPU是至关重要的。通常情况下,选择性能强劲的GPU可以显著加快训练速度。
  • 推荐选择NVIDIA的RTX 30系列或Quadro系列的显卡,或者AMD的Radeon VII系列显卡。

内存要求

  • 在进行ChatGPT训练时,大量的数据需要被加载到内存中进行处理,因此需要足够大的内存来支持训练过程。
  • 推荐选择至少64GB的内存,以确保在训练过程中不会因为内存不足而导致性能下降。

存储要求

  • 由于训练过程中会产生大量的中间数据和模型参数,因此需要足够大的存储空间来存储这些数据。
  • 推荐选择高速的SSD存储,以确保数据读写的效率。

如何选择合适的硬件配置

  • 在选择硬件配置时,需要根据实际的训练需求和预算来进行权衡。可以参考一些已经公开的ChatGPT训练案例,来了解相应的硬件配置。
  • 可以考虑购买云端的GPU实例来进行训练,这样可以根据需要灵活调整硬件配置,并且不需要承担硬件维护的成本。

常见问题FAQ

ChatGPT训练是否需要专业的服务器?

  • 是的,由于ChatGPT训练需要大量的计算资源,因此通常情况下需要专业的服务器来支持。

我可以在个人电脑上进行ChatGPT训练吗?

  • 对于小规模的训练任务,可以在个人电脑上进行尝试,但对于大规模的训练任务,通常需要更强大的硬件支持。

是否可以通过云端服务进行ChatGPT训练?

  • 是的,许多云端服务提供了强大的GPU实例来支持深度学习模型的训练,可以考虑使用云端服务来进行ChatGPT训练。
正文完